North America’s salmon powerhouse, Bristol Bay, Alaska, is threatened by the massive proposed gold and copper mine. Working closely with commercial fishermen, tribes, sportsmen and women, local businesses and many others across the country, Trout Unlimited works to protect these iconic and productive rivers and the people they support.
In August 2020, the U.S. Army Corps of Engineers found “under section 404 of the Clean Water Act that the project, as proposed, would likely result in significant degradation of the environment and would likely result in significant adverse effects on the aquatic system or human environment.” Their statement that the current Pebble proposal wouldn’t be permitted sends the project back to the drawing board and up against major hurdles in order to advance. But Pebble isn’t gone completely. We still need Pebble’s permit to be outright denied.
